R'S CAR FOR LE CANADELHenry Royce's French residence.

R.{Sir Henry Royce} is taking 18-EX car to Le CanadelHenry Royce's French residence in about 6 or 7 weeks. Before it leaves we want to fit to it as many new parts as possible. On the engine unit we wish to fit :-

(1) T.50 alloy cylinder head.
(2) Cylinders which have been treated to reduce scaling
(3) Large dia. crank, con. rods to suit.
(4) New type slipper wheel, low inertia type.
(5) Exhaust heated carburetter.
(6) Modified clutch (particulars later)
(7) Carburetter with single intake.
(8) Pistons with invar struts.
(9) Tappets with bronze guides.
(10) Extra oil to cylinders.
(11) Exhaust valves made with Firths Crown Steel.

The other features we wish to fit are :-

(12) Chromium plated parts in place of nickel.
(13) Radiator either chromium or staybrite.
(14) Thermostat controlled shutters.
(15) New exhaust system (if tests satisfactory)
